Color contrast ratio for standard text

Standard text and images of text must have a contrast ratio of at least 4.5:1 to meet WCAG AA standards.

Color contrast ratio for large text

Large text (at least 24px regular and light weight, or 19px semi-bold weight) must have a contrast ratio of at least 3:1 to meet WCAG AA standards.

Color contrast ratio for UI components

UI components must have a contrast ratio of at least 3:1 to meet WCAG AA standards.

Text contrast on gradient and image backgrounds

When text is rendered on a gradient background or image, the text color must meet contrast standards in all places it appears. This is especially important for parallax applications or animations where text and backgrounds move independently.

UI component visual states require contrast

Visual information used to indicate states and boundaries of UI components must have a contrast ratio of 3:1 against adjacent colors, per IBM checkpoint 1.4.11 Non-text Contrast.

Do not rely on color alone to convey meaning

Do not rely on color alone to convey information, indicate an action, prompt the user for a response, or distinguish one visual element from another. This ensures accessibility for users with color blindness.

Test color visibility with color-blind simulators

When designing with color, use a color-blind simulator to review the visibility of content. The Stark plugin is recommended for Figma.

Carbon accessibility approach for visual impairments

Carbon components are designed to accommodate the entire spectrum of visual impairment, including low vision, color blindness, and complete blindness. Designers must exercise diligence to ensure components are used correctly.

Color-blindness prevalence

Color-blindness affects 8% of all men and 0.4% of women.

Color-blind users interface experience

Color-blind users will not be able to differentiate between some colors on an interface and rely on non-color information to use an interface.

Carbon color theme contrast compliance

Carbon color themes strive to comply with the WCAG 2.1 AA guidelines for contrast. The color palette should ensure avoiding contrast issues when used correctly.

Stark plugin for color accessibility testing

For designers working in Figma, the Stark plugin is recommended for testing color accessibility and contrast issues.
